Developing analytical skills is as important as having access to data. In the most recent trading session, MTX experienced a slight pullback of 0.78%, closing at $75.4. The decline occurred on what appeared to be normal trading activity, with no extreme volume spikes that might indicate panic selling or institutional accumulation. The broader materials sector has been navigating mixed signals from commodity prices and global demand expectations, and Minerals Technologies appears to be moving in line with its peer group. The company’s diversified portfolio, spanning specialty minerals, refractories, and environmental products, may provide some insulation against sector-specific headwinds. However, near-term price action suggests investors are weighing macroeconomic uncertainties, including interest rate expectations and industrial production trends. At $75.4, the stock is positioned closer to its support floor than to its resistance ceiling, which could imply that downside risks are partially priced in. Any catalyst related to earnings revisions, new product announcements, or favorable regulatory developments could potentially shift sentiment, but for now, the stock is consolidating within a defined range. From a technical perspective, MTX is trading within a well-defined band. The support level at $71.63 represents a price zone where buying interest has historically emerged, while resistance at $79.17 has capped upward moves in recent months. The current price of $75.4 sits roughly midway between these two levels, indicating indecision among market participants. Momentum indicators, such as the Relative Strength Index, are likely hovering in the neutral 40–60 range, suggesting the stock is neither overbought nor oversold. The moving average structure may reveal a flattening or slightly bearish crossover, depending on the timeframe examined. Price action over the past several sessions shows a series of higher lows near support, which could be interpreted as a potential base-building pattern. However, without a clear breakout above resistance, the technical picture remains ambiguous. Volume analysis does not show any abnormal distribution or accumulation patterns, reinforcing the view that the stock is in a consolidation phase. A sustained move above $79.17 would signal renewed bullish momentum, while a break below $71.63 could open the door to further downside.
